Abstract
Conventionally, hardware monitoring has been performed using manually controlled off-line devices.It is suggested that a hardware monitor incorporating program control and acting as an intelligent peripheral device would realize greater utility and wider application. The development and application of such a device is described; a combination of the merits of both software and hardware monitoring techniques is claimed for it.Keywords
